Latest World News as of June 11, 2025

United States

  • Large-scale immigration protests have erupted in Los Angeles, with nearly 100 arrests reported amid a heavy military presence. President Donald Trump defended his decision to send Marines and additional troops to the city, stating his intent to “liberate” Los Angeles. The city remains under an emergency curfew as demonstrations continue into a fifth day, largely fueled by the city’s complex ethnic and demographic makeup[2][5].
  • The CDC faced internal unrest after workers protested the recent decision by RFK Jr. to purge the agency’s entire vaccine panel[2].
  • An alleged plot to target Jewish people in New York City using assault-style rifles was foiled by the FBI, averting what could have been a major attack[2].
  • A fire disrupted service to New York’s Grand Central Station, causing significant commuter delays[2].

International Affairs

  • The United States and China announced a new trade framework agreement aimed at stabilizing relations and keeping a tariff truce in place. As part of the deal, China agreed to remove export restrictions on rare earth elements, though broader trade tensions remain unresolved[3][5].
  • In the UK, Canada, Australia, New Zealand, and Norway have joined forces to sanction Israeli government ministers, including Israel’s national security minister Ben-Gvir and finance minister Smotrich. These measures—asset freezes and travel bans—come in response to accusations of “inciting violence” against Palestinians[5].

Europe

  • Austria is reeling from a tragic school rampage that resulted in 10 deaths, marking one of the deadliest attacks in the country’s recent history[2].
